Frenetic comic Robin Williams didn't wait for David Letterman's cue to kick off his routine on "The Late Show" Thursday -- he was already well into it within five seconds of sitting down, leaving a blinking Letterman trying to keep up as Williams went to town on the RNC crowd, starting with vice presidential nominee Sarah Palin and on up to Karl Rove.
